splice-string
Remove or replace part of a string like `Array#splice`
Last updated 5 years ago by sindresorhus .
MIT · Repository · Bugs · Original npm · Tarball · package.json
$ cnpm install splice-string 
SYNC missed versions from official npm registry.

splice-string

Remove or replace part of a string like Array#splice

It correctly handles slicing strings with emoji.

Install

$ npm install splice-string

Usage

import spliceString from 'splice-string';

spliceString('unicorn', 3, 4, 'verse');
//=> 'universe'

spliceString('❤️????????', 1, 1, '????');
//=> '❤️????????'

API

spliceString(string, index, count, insert?)

string

Type: string

index

Type: number

Index to start splicing.

count

Type: number

Number of characters to remove.

insert

Type: string

String to insert in place of the removed substring.

Current Tags

  • 3.0.0                                ...           latest (5 years ago)

3 Versions

  • 3.0.0                                ...           5 years ago
  • 2.0.0                                ...           10 years ago
  • 1.0.0                                ...           11 years ago
Maintainers (1)
Downloads
Today 0
This Week 0
This Month 0
Last Day 0
Last Week 0
Last Month 1
Dependencies (1)
Dev Dependencies (2)
Dependents (2)

Copyright 2013 - present © cnpmjs.org | Home |